Output 21bb5c69a0e2a196af8dd7bef6dca07918b7a2d9c8d7e976da2905d86bcaedc8:0

value
1024023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fadb41439248f221c7a1148eb5713af8980df571 OP_EQUAL
address
3QZRWbqca2UN3wvBBHuHHv38cV8NHWQWDu
transaction
21bb5c69a0e2a196af8dd7bef6dca07918b7a2d9c8d7e976da2905d86bcaedc8
spent
true